CAS 132682-77-0: 2-DIPHENYLPHOSPHINO-6-METHYLPYRIDINE
Description:2-Diphenylphosphino-6-methylpyridine is a chemical compound characterized by its unique structure, which includes a pyridine ring substituted with a methyl group and a diphenylphosphino group. This compound typically exhibits properties associated with both phosphines and nitrogen-containing heterocycles, making it a valuable ligand in coordination chemistry. It is often utilized in catalysis, particularly in transition metal complexes, due to its ability to stabilize metal centers and facilitate various chemical reactions. The presence of the diphenylphosphino group enhances its electron-donating ability, while the methylpyridine moiety can influence the sterics and electronics of the resulting complexes. Additionally, 2-diphenylphosphino-6-methylpyridine may exhibit solubility in organic solvents, which is advantageous for its application in synthetic chemistry. Safety data should be consulted for handling, as with any chemical substance, to ensure proper precautions are taken. Overall, this compound is significant in the field of organometallic chemistry and catalysis.
